2 Chronicles 30:10  (1611 King James Bible)

Viewing the 1611 King James Version. Click to switch to standard King James Version of 2 Chronicles 30:10


So the Posts passed from citie to citie, through the countrey of Ephraim and Manasseh, euen vnto Zebulun: but they laughed them to scorne, and mocked them.



- 1611 King James Bible

View Wesley's Notes for 2 Chronicles 30:10

30:10 They - The generality of the ten tribes; who by long want of meat had now lost their appetite to God's ordinances, for which they paid dear. For about six years after their refusal of this offer of grace they were all carried away captive, #2Kings 18:1|,10.
